Mid-Size Scooters
Mid-sized scooters have a greater speed range than smaller travel scooters. They are also more maneuverable and easy to park. However, they weigh more than class 2 scooters.

They are simple to use
A medium scooter is easy to operate even for newbies. You can find many models with adjustable handlebars, speed controls along with front and rear lights as well as reflectors. These features improve visibility on dark streets and in traffic. It is also important to read the manual of the manufacturer and practice riding on a parking lot or a quiet street prior to using your scooter in public. Also, you should be aware of the safety requirements including a weight capacity and braking system.

Another factor to consider is how much you plan to ride on a regular basis. Smaller scooters may not be sufficient to cover the distance you require for your daily commute. Larger scooters can be difficult to maneuver in narrow doorways. A class 3 scooter would be a better choice when you intend to travel for long distances. These scooters are larger and can travel further.
It is crucial to consider the ground clearance of the scooter, in addition to its size and range. This is the space between the wheels of a scooter. It is essential for people living on uneven terrain or hills. Small scooters have lower ground clearance than larger models, and can get stuck on objects or over curbs.
If you're looking for a lighter scooter, you should look for one made of titanium or aluminum bars. These materials are strong and durable, but they can be more expensive than steel. There are also different handlebar shapes and styles from standard to oversized. Some can be adjusted in height while others have steering dampeners built into them to ensure you stay on the right track at high speeds.
You must be able to balance well and have good manual dexterity to operate the scooter. You can choose the standard T-shaped tiller or a delta tiller, that can be controlled with either hand. Both types require constant pressure to propel the scooter forward, and removing the pressure can result in the brake. You can also use a throttle lever change the speed of the scooter.
They are also affordable
A mid-range scooter is the ideal option if you want to get around town quickly and comfortably. These models offer great value-for-money, with plenty of features that will keep you safe and comfortable on your ride. Some of them have front and rear mechanical discs brakes that regenerative power, while others feature adjustable suspension to give you a more comfortable riding experience. They also have a slim stem for easy transport and folding. Some have a retractable basket that can be used for additional storage space.
Medium scooters are a more affordable alternative to class 2 models. They're still capable of top speeds and can travel for up to 25-30 kilometers on a single charge. They are an excellent choice for commuters who want to make a few quick trips or cut down on parking charges.

They are at ease
Full-size mobility Scooters are perfect for those who require more stability and comfort, especially during long journeys. These heavy-duty vehicles have a larger wheelbase than their three-wheel counterparts. This allows them to accommodate a wider range of weights. These vehicles also have suspension systems and tires that provide a smooth and safe ride over various surfaces. Some models also have batteries that can last up to 40 kilometers, making them ideal for longer trips.
Full-size 3 wheelers can have more powerful motors and allow for a wider range of users, while maintaining greater stability. Designed with all-day use in mind, these scooters provide comfortable and spacious seats that are padded and designed to offer the rider a comfortable experience with no discomfort. Furthermore, their bigger deck size gives more leg room and more space to move.
Another aspect to consider is the size of the wheels on the scooter. Smaller wheels could cause the scooter to be less stable than a larger model, and may be difficult to drive on uneven terrain. Some smaller scooters also have narrower turn radiuses, which can make them difficult to maneuver in busy places such as shopping malls.
When choosing a mid-sized scooter it is also important to consider the vehicle's transportation and storage capabilities. Look for models that disassemble easily for easy transport and storage in your home or car. Some also feature an executive seat that provides additional comfort and convenience.
Take into consideration the scooter's ability to handle various terrains, as well as its battery capacity and life. A few mid-sized scooters feature a robust suspension system that can handle different types of terrain. For those who want simplicity and reliability will prefer spring suspension, while those looking for a more customizable and more comfortable riding experience can opt for hydraulic suspension.
In terms of battery life, most medium-sized scooters can travel up to 16 miles on a single charge. If you intend to travel for long distances or require extended durations, it's a good idea to consider scooters with larger batteries and greater ranges.
They are convenient
Medium scooters are an environmentally-friendly alternative to cars, trucks, and motorbikes. It's more efficient in energy use and produces zero emissions. It's also easy to park and maneuver. It's also enjoyable to ride, and it can be used by people of any age or fitness level. Just like bikes, scooters are great for commutes and can make life in cities more enjoyable.
There are a variety of scooters available on market, and it's essential to choose one that fits your lifestyle and budget. If you intend to use the scooter for outdoor use, pick a model with four wheels and larger tire sizes. buy electric mobility scooters can handle bumps, rough terrain, and other obstacles much more easily than three wheelers. The ground clearance of the scooter is crucial, as it determines how well it handles uneven surfaces.
If you're looking for a bike that is able to travel further pick a mid-size model that has more powerful motors and higher top speed. These models are more expensive than smaller scooters, but they provide greater speed and endurance. Certain models also have the delta tiller that allows you to control the throttle lever using either hand.
Medium-powered scooters are perfect for city rides, since they have a decent range and can climb inclines easily. They're also a good choice for those who value convenience over portability.
In addition to their convenient size medium scooters are quieter than regular automobiles. They don't emit the "vroom" sound that is typical of motorcars, and they can be driven in crowded streets without causing disruption to pedestrians. These advantages can enhance the quality of life in urban areas as they decrease noise and traffic congestion.
Medium scooters are also more easy to maneuver than cars, because they have a smaller turning radius. They can easily fit into small spaces and narrow doors making them an ideal option for indoor usage. They are also less expensive than cars since they do not require an annual registration or expensive insurance. In addition, they're a good choice for commuters who want to save money on maintenance and fuel costs.
